Mac 向け MySQL のインストールと設定のチュートリアル

Mac 向け MySQL のインストールと設定のチュートリアル

この記事では、MacでのMySQLインストールチュートリアルを参考までに紹介します。具体的な内容は次のとおりです。

まずダウンロードする必要があります

MySQL コミュニティ サーバーのダウンロード アドレス: https://dev.mysql.com/downloads/mysql/

MySQL ダウンロード ページ (https://dev.mysql.com/downloads/mysql/) にアクセスします。Mac OS を使用している場合は、デフォルトで Mac OS X プラットフォームが選択されます。以下は、Mac OS で使用できるすべての MySQL バージョンです。他のプラットフォームを使用している場合は、[プラットフォームの選択] オプションのドロップダウン リストから選択するだけです。

Mac OS には MySQL のバージョンが多数あり、10.5/10.6 などのプラットフォームに基づくものや、32 ビットと 64 ビットのものがあります。システムに応じて選択できます。ファイルの拡張子は .tar.gz と .dmg です。ここでは .dmg を選択しました。ダウンロードするには右側のダウンロードをクリックしてください。

次に、別のインターフェースにリダイレクトされ、登録が必要かどうかを尋ねられます。一番下にある「いいえ、ダウンロードに進みます」を選択してください。次に、ダウンロード用のサーバーが多数リストされているダウンロード インターフェースにリダイレクトされます。1 つを選択してダウンロードを開始してください。

pkg ファイルをダブルクリックして、下までインストールします。最後のポップアップ ボックスのパスワードを忘れずに保存してください (これは、mysql ルート アカウントのパスワードです)


MYSQL2.png通常の状況では、インストールは成功します。

この時点でインストールは成功していますが、追加の構成が必要です。

(1)システム環境設定に入る


(2)mysqlをクリック


(3)MySQLサービスを起動する


このとき、コマンドラインに mysql -u root -p コマンドを入力すると、コマンドが見つからないというメッセージが表示されます。また、システム環境変数に mysql を追加する必要があります。

(1). /usr/local/mysql/bin に入り、このディレクトリに mysql があるかどうかを確認します (図 6 を参照)。
(2) vim ~/.bash_profileを実行する
mysql/bin ディレクトリをファイルに追加します (pic7 を参照)。
PATH=$PATH:/usr/local/mysql/bin
追加したら、esc キーを押して wq と入力し、変更を保存します。
最後に、コマンドラインにsource ~/.bash_profileと入力します。



これで、mysql -u root -p で mysql にログインできるようになりました。パスワード (pic3 の >fj) の入力を求められます...
ログインに成功したら、次のコマンドでパスワードを変更できます。

'root'@'localhost'のパスワードを設定= PASSWORD('mysql123456');

以上がこの記事の全内容です。皆様の勉強のお役に立てれば幸いです。また、123WORDPRESS.COM を応援していただければ幸いです。

以下もご興味があるかもしれません:
  • MACでMYSQLデータベースのパスワードを忘れた場合の解決策
  • MySQL 5.7 と Mac 上の MySql の詳細なインストール図をダウンロードする
  • Mac OS に MySQL 5.7.20 をインストールするための詳細なグラフィックとテキストの説明
  • Linux/Mac に MySQL をインストールするときにパスワードを忘れた場合の解決策
  • Mac OS X で Apache + PHP + MySQL オペレーティング環境を構成するための詳細な手順
  • MacにMySQLをインストールするときに初期パスワードを忘れた場合の対処方法
  • MacにMySQLをインストールするときに忘れたパスワードを変更する方法
  • Macにmysql5.7.18をインストールする詳細な手順
  • Mac での MySql の詳細なインストールと構成
  • Mac でソースコードから MySQL 5.7.17 をコンパイルしてインストールするチュートリアル
  • MACでMySQLパスワードを忘れた場合の解決策
  • Mac での MySQL と Squel Pro の設定

<<:  WeChat アプレットのカスタム タブバー コンポーネント

>>:  Dockerfile を使用して Docker でイメージを構築する方法

推薦する

mysql の認証、起動、およびサービスの起動のための一般的なコマンド

1. 4つの起動方法: 1.mysqld MySQL サーバーを起動します: ./mysqld --...

Linux での mysql および mysql.sock のインストールに関する問題

最近、Linux に Aphace、mysql、php をインストールするときに多くの問題に遭遇しま...

MySQLでインデックスエラーが発生する状況について簡単に説明します

以下に、トレーニング機関からのヒントと私自身の要約をいくつか示します。以下のインデックスの内容を説明...

JavaScript リフレクション学習のヒント

目次1. はじめに2. インターフェース3. 簡単な例4. 結論1. はじめにMDN の公式 Web...

MySQL MHA のセットアップと切り替えに関するいくつかのエラー ログの概要

1: masterha_check_repl レプリカ セット エラー レプリケートが構成ファイルで...

IIS7 IIS8 http は自動的に HTTPS にジャンプします (ポート 80 はポート 443 にジャンプします)

IIS7 では、「URL REWRITE2」疑似静的モジュールがインストールされているかどうかを確...

Vue における v-for のキーの一意性の詳細な説明

目次1. DOM の違い2. 同じレイヤーの同じタイプの要素にキー属性を追加する3. キーはインデッ...

ReactとAntdのFormコンポーネントを組み合わせてログイン機能を実装する方法を詳しく説明します

目次1. ReactとAntdを組み合わせてログイン機能を実現2. ReactとAntdを組み合わせ...

WeChatアプレットでQRコードを識別するために長押しする実装プロセス

序文公式アカウントのQRコードは長押しで認識できることは皆さんご存じですが、ミニプログラムに対する制...

MySQL ログインおよび終了コマンドの形式

mysql ログインのコマンド形式は次のとおりです。 mysql -h [hostip] -u [ユ...

Vue プロジェクトで addRoutes を使用する際の問題の解決策

目次序文1. 404 ページ1. 原因2. 解決策2.白い画面を更新する1. 原因2. 解決策3. ...

Nodejs でタイムドクローラーを実装する完全な例

目次事件の原因Node Scheduleを使用してスケジュールされたタスクを実装する1. node-...

nginx がどのようにして高いパフォーマンスとスケーラビリティを実現するのかを深く理解する

NGINX の全体的なアーキテクチャは、連携して動作する一連のプロセスによって特徴付けられます。メイ...

Docker を使用した nextcloud パーソナル ネットワーク ディスクの構築に関するチュートリアル

目次1. はじめに2. 導入環境ツール4. 展開プロセス要約する1. はじめにNextcloud は...

CSS でフロートをクリアするための完全ガイド (要約)

1. 親divは疑似クラスafterとzoomを定義します <スタイル タイプ="...